The place of Club de Tiro y Pesca is inside the municipality of Cajeme (in the State of Sonora). There are 3 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#623 of the ranking. Club de Tiro y Pesca is at 69 meters of altitude.

The Mexican census of 2020 decided to declare this community as uninhabited.

Do you want to locate the town of Club de Tiro y Pesca? You can find it at 10.2 kilometers, in direction East, from the town of Ciudad Obregón, which has the largest population within the municipality.
